Position Summary
F5 is seeking a proactive, energetic, and enthusiastic Buyer II to join our Procurement team. The Buyer II will serve as a key contributor in procurement operations with a strong focus on Coupa platform excellence, supplier management, and cross-functional collaboration. The ideal candidate is some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ment, is willing to wear multiple hats, and is committed to delivering high-quality outcomes for both internal and external stakeholders.
Primary Responsibilities
Support internal stakeholders on purchase requests and purchase order processes within the Coupa Procurement platform
Assist in the implementation and maintenance of supplier catalogues within Coupa, contributing to user adoption and procurement efficiency
Execute requisitions from submission to supplier transmission, ensuring accuracy and compliance with established procurement procedures
Help maintain and update Coupa best practices documentation, training materials, and user guides to support the overall procurement experience
Assist in monitoring compliance with company procurement policies, procedures, and internal controls
Collaborate with Finance, Accounting, and other internal teams to gather and analyze purchasing requirements and support alignment with organizational goals
Support projects related to procurement process improvements and system enhancements, contributing to operational efficiencies
Identify and communicate opportunities to improve procurement workflows, with input from senior team members
Contribute to data gathering, reporting, and dashboard updates to support procurement KPIs and management review
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
Growing knowledge of procurement strategies and supplier relationship management
Hands-on experience with the Coupa Procurement platform, including catalogue support, requisition processing, and purchase order management
Developing understanding of procure-to-pay (P2P) processes and best practices
Good organizational and time management sk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ks under moderate supervision
Strong interpersonal and communication skills with a customer-service mindset
Collaborative, dependable, and eager to exercise judgment within defined procedures and guidelines
Ability to work effectively within a team in a fast-paced, dynamic environment
Analytical mindset with attention to detail and a clear, concise communication style
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, PowerPoint, Word)
Qualifications
Required:
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, Finance, or a related field (or equivalent work experience)
3+ years of progressive experience in procurement, purchasing, or supply chain operations
1+ years of hands-on experience with Coupa Procurement, including catalogue implementation and management
Demonstrated experience providing white-glove/concierge-level procurement support
Proven track record of managing requisition-to-PO processes with speed and accuracy
Experience collaborating with cross-functional teams including Finance and Accounting
Preferred:
Knowledge of Icertis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M) platform
Familiarity with AI-powered tools and technologies (e.g., Gemini, Copilot, ChatGPT)
Experience in the technology industry
